6th Grade -Byzantine

Mr. Stickler's Byzantine/ Islamic Empire unit test cards.

QuestionAnswer
What is "Greek Fire" made of? Petroleum.
How did the location of Constantinople relate to ancient trade routes? location in the Black Sea made it a natural hub for ships & traders. - It's central location in the Black Sea made it a natural hub for ships & traders.
Why was the empire called "Byzantine"? Because the city of Byzantium became the new capital of the Eastern Roman Empire. It was renamed Constantinople
What is a "strait"? A narrow passage that links two bodies of water.
What does "schism" mean? A split.
The Byzantine Empire collapsed after what emperor died in 565 C.E.? Justinian.
What is the name for "paintings of saints and holy people"? Icons.
What caused the Byzantine Empire to crumble? Arguments about religion & politics.
Why is the Code of Justinian important? It became the "backbone of the legal systems of many European nations.
What are the 5 Pillars of Islam? 1.) Belief in one god; 2.) Prayer 5 x a day; 3.) Giving alms to the poor & sick; 4.) Fast during Ramadan; 5.) If able, make the "hajj" to Mecca.
What does the word "hajj" mean? "Pilgrimmage."
What is a minaret & what is it used for? "A tower." It's used for calling Muslims to prayer.
What did Muhammad call Christians & Jews? Why? "People of the book." He respected them.
Why did Muhammad respect Christians & Jews? They all believed in 1 god, too.
In 656, whose death "split the Muslim world in two"? Uthman.
What is the name of the 2 groups of Muslims? Shiite & Sunni.
What did/ do Shiites believe that makes them different (from Sunnis)? That the ruler should be a direct descendant of Muhammad.
What one belief do the Sunnis hold that makes them different from Shiites? No one man, not even Islamic leaders, should tell Muslims what the Quran taught.
What is the name of the Muslim holy book? Quran.
True or False: Muhammad believed that men & women were unequal. False. He believed all people are equal no matter what.
True or False: The Sunnis are the largest groups of Muslims worldwide. True.
What is a "caliph"? A chief ruler of Islam.
What is "tolerance"? Acceptance of differences.
What is the "Kabah"? Large, black building that is cube - shaped. It lies in the center of Mecca. During the Hajj, Muslims circle it 7 times and then touch & kiss the "black stone" in the Kabah.
What goods did the desert camel trains carry on desert supply trains? Perfumes, ivory, spices, silk, & precious metals such as gold.
What happened to Muhammad in 622? He & his followers went to Yathrib from Mecca.
What is a "prophet"? A person who carries God's message.
What is the "Hijra"? The term for the "migration" of early Muslims from Mecca to Yathrib.
Why did Islam spread so far so fast after Muhammad died (in 632)? People did not like the Byzantine or Persian Empires.
What does "Medina" mean? "City" - short for "City of the Prophet".
